Camps-sur-l'Isle is a commune in the Gironde department in Aquitaine in southwestern France.
Population
| Historical population | ||
|---|---|---|
| Year | Pop. | ±% |
| 1962 | 297 | — |
| 1968 | 356 | +19.9% |
| 1975 | 376 | +5.6% |
| 1982 | 377 | +0.3% |
| 1990 | 379 | +0.5% |
| 1999 | 388 | +2.4% |
| 2008 | 495 | +27.6% |
